Logline: A long time ago in a distant fairy tale countryside, a young girl leads her little brother into a dark wood in desperate search of food and work, only to stumble upon a nexus of terrifying evil.

Episode Overview
In this episode, Geoffrey D. Calhoun and Kristy Leigh Lussier provide an in-depth analysis of the film 'Gretel & Hansel'. They dissect the creative and narrative elements of this dark retelling of the Brothers Grimm fairy tale, exploring its thematic depth and filmmaking techniques.
Key Discussion Points
- Narrative and Thematic Analysis - Examining the storytelling and themes in 'Gretel & Hansel'.
- Cinematic Techniques - Discussing the film's unique visual and directorial style.
- Adapting Classic Tales - Insights into modern retellings of traditional stories.
